Introduction to HakiElimu
HakiElimu is an independent civil society organization dedicated to human rights and education. The organization, founded in 2001, works to transform education by influencing policy, stimulating public dialogue, conducting research, and collaborating with partners. Their vision is an open, just, and democratic Tanzania where everyone has the right to an education that promotes equity, creativity, and critical thinking.
